Backup Exec for SBS, when SBS is virtual

Hi all,

 

I have been tearing my hair out the last few days trying to find a cost effective way for one of my clients to back up their data. We use Backup Exec and Backup Exec Server Recover at 90% of our clients and would like to continure to use it in this situation:

 

We plan to install the following hardware / software:

  • 1 physical machine with tape drive (HP Ultrium)
  • 2 virtual machines running in Hyper V, 1 is SBS 2011 the other being Server 2008 R2 Standard

 

Our Goal:

  • To have a tape backup every night, which includes files / folders / exchange that sit on the virtual SBS
  • To have an image taken every weekend of the host machine, using symantec backup exec server recovery, onto an external HDD

Our Questions / Concerns:

  • For cost means, we would like to purchase a SBS OEM bundle. We have purchased a few of these, and they include both Symantec Backup Exec 2010 R2 for SBS AND Symantec Backup Exec Server Recovery 2010 for SBS
  • According to http://www.symantec.com/business/support/index?page=content&id=TECH125965 we can install Symantec Backup Exec 2010 R2 on the host machine using our SBS license in the pack mentioned above. But, what does this actually mean? Sure, we get to install BUE on the host machine so it can write to tape drive, but I want to back up files, folder and exchange on my virtual SBS. Do we need extra licensing? Detail here would be great
  • Do we need to purchase a Hyper-V agent to be able to back up our second virtualised machine (Server 2008 R2 standard), even though though this operating system is included with SBS premium?
  • Can we also install Symantec Backup Exec Server Recovery on the host using the SBS license?

  • Let me be very simple in my response:

    -->> If you have a Hyper-V Virtual machine on which SBS Operating System is installed, then YOU CAN install the Backup Exec on the Hyper-V host machine and use the Backup exec SBS License key. You just have to ensure that during the installation of Backup Exec on the Hyper-V host you need to have the SBS virtual machine up and running.

    -->> If you have only 2 Hyper- V virtual machines then there is no need to buy license for Agent for Hyper-V in Backup Exec. Just buy 2 Remote agent license which will be much cheaper then buying a Hyper-V agent. Install the remote agent on 2 Virtual machines.

         In future if you are plannning to increase the number of virtual machines more than say 5 then buying Hyper-V agent will be cost effective.

    -->> I dont think you will be able to install Backup Exec System Recovery with SBS license on the host machine as the host machine is standard machine. Just use the standard license and take the complete backup of you Host which will also backup the VHD files of Virtual machine so that you can bring backup the Virtual machine easily during disaster.
